Item Description
Did you ever try to learn to play music from the "teach yourself" instructional books or videos out there? Did the uninspiring songs, exercises and the whole approach to "learning music" kind of leave you cold? Well you are not alone. People have been passing music on to each other for centuries, and usually not by lessons and books.
To the rescue comes Harvey Reid & Joyce Andersen's 4th collaboration recording, a monumental 4-CD boxed set titled"The Song Train"
These versatile musicians have assembled and recorded beautiful versions of an amazing collection of folk, blues, country, celtic, gospel, old-time, bluegrass and rock songs. These songs are a cross-section of the American musical experience, and they have been recorded by an incredible line-up of artists over the years. None of the songs has more than two chords, and they are delivered here with only basic acoustic guitar to drive the music.
